The Man Behind the Machine
Royal Raymond Rife was an American inventor with a passion for microscopy and bacteriology. Born in 1888, he didn't follow a traditional scientific path. Instead, he worked independently, fueled by a belief that he could find a single cause for many diseases, including cancer.
Rife was a tinkerer and a builder. He designed and constructed his own tools, which he believed were far superior to anything available at the time. His primary focus was on building microscopes that could overcome the limitations of the era.
A New Way of Seeing
In the early 20th century, microscopes had a major drawback. To see something as small as a virus, scientists had to use electron microscopes, which killed the specimen. This meant they could only study dead viruses. Rife wanted to see live microorganisms in their natural state.
To solve this, he developed a series of optical microscopes, culminating in what he called the "Universal Microscope." It was a complex instrument with thousands of parts. Rife claimed it could magnify objects up to 60,000 times their original size using a clever system of prisms and intense light.
More importantly, Rife claimed his microscope allowed him to see living microbes by illuminating them with light of specific frequencies. He believed that by rotating prisms, he could stain the microbe with light, causing it to glow in a distinct color, making it visible even when it was still alive.
According to Rife, every microorganism had a unique color signature, visible only when illuminated by a specific frequency of light.
The Frequency Theory
From his observations, Rife developed a radical theory. He proposed that every microorganism had its own unique frequency, or Mortal Oscillatory Rate (MOR). He believed that if you could expose a disease-causing organism to a beam of energy tuned to its specific MOR, the organism would vibrate and be destroyed.
Think of it like an opera singer shattering a crystal glass by singing a single, sustained note. The glass has a natural resonant frequency. When the singer's voice matches that frequency, the vibrations become too great for the glass to handle, and it shatters. Rife claimed his machine could do the same thing to pathogens, but with electromagnetic waves instead of sound.
This idea led him to develop his most famous invention: the Rife frequency generator, often called the "Rife machine." It was designed to produce low-energy electromagnetic waves at various frequencies. The user would tune the machine to the specific MOR of a microbe, and the machine would then emit that frequency, supposedly destroying the pathogen without harming the surrounding healthy tissue.
